Found a nice bit burr which I think is apple (don't know why but I do:)) and set about it today.

I boiled it in coffee and chagga to try and give a darker finish but not much happened.

I've also given it a boil in milk to try that and see.
007 (700x643).jpg

004 (700x389).jpg

005 (700x527).jpg

It's had a coat of walnut oil and is drying outside. Hopefully the milk boil and oil coat will slow the drying.

I'd love to say I only used 3 tools (purists don't read any further) but I do cheat a bit!:eek:

I rough out the outside with a chainsaw disc on the hand grinder then a flap sanding disc. This saves a lot of time and my sore elbow!

After that its a straight knife and a hook knife, that's all. Oh, and a bit sand paper. It did take 6 hours though so I know what you mean about time.
